Airbus to deliver several helicopters to Ukraine this year – Interior Ministry

French company Airbus Helicopters will deliver several more helicopters to Ukraine by the end of 2019, Ukraine's Deputy Interior Minister Serhiy Honcharov has said.

"We expect another two or three machines this year. This is a changing figure, as the transfer of equipment is expected at the end of the year and everything will depend on the weather conditions. In addition, we plan to get H125s in the fourth quarter of this year, which is earlier than expected. This is a single-engine helicopter that will be used to train flight crews in Ukraine," the press service of the Ukrainian Interior Ministry quoted him as saying.

Honcharov stressed that four helicopters had arrived in Ukraine since the signing of a contract with the French company and that three of them had already been transferred for the needs of the State Emergency Service and another is being used by the National Guard.

On July 14, 2018, the Ukrainian Interior Ministry signed a contract with Airbus Helicopters for the purchase of 55 H225, H145 and H125 helicopters for the ministry.
